Why do laws continue to evolve ​

English
1 answer:
Nataliya [291]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Changing community values: Another reason why laws may need to change is due to changing community values. Values across society changes over time. ... In order to remain relevant, the law must uphold and reflect the values and beliefs of society in the present time.
